.elementor-994744 .elementor-element.elementor-element-86a7f45 {
    --container-widget-height: 100%;
}

.elementor-kit-9 button, .elementor-kit-9 input[type="button"], .elementor-kit-9 input[type="submit"], .elementor-kit-9 .elementor-button {
    font-size: 36px;
    line-height: 2em;
}
#payment-title {
	display: none;
}
.nav-pills .nav-link.active, .nav-pills .show>.nav-link {
    background-color: #116b3f;
}
.donate-now-container .btn-danger {
    color: white;
    text-decoration: none;
}
.btn-danger {
    color: white;
    background-image: -webkit-gradient(linear, 0 0, 0 100%, from(#11683f), to(#183526));
    background-image: -webkit-linear-gradient(top, #116B3f, #183526);
    background-image: -o-linear-gradient(top, #116B3f, #183526 );
    background-image: linear-gradient(top, #116B3f, #183526 );
    border-color: #116B3f #116B3f #183526 ;
}

#recurring-area .btn-secondary, #recurring-area input.active {
    background-color: #116B3f;
    color: white;
    padding: 5px 5px;
    text-decoration: none;
}
.elementor-994744 .elementor-element.elementor-element-6afb74c8:not(.elementor-motion-effects-element-type-background), .elementor-994744 .elementor-element.elementor-element-6afb74c8 > .elementor-motion-effects-container > .elementor-motion-effects-layer {
    max-height: 200px;
}

body .select2-search--dropdown, body .select2.select2-container .select2-selection[role=combobox], body input[type=date], body input[type=email], body input[type=number], body input[type=password], body input[type=range], body input[type=search], body input[type=tel], body input[type=text], body input[type=url], body select, body textarea {
    border-width: 0.5px;
    border-style: solid;
    border-color: grey;
}
